I. Introduction to Forex Swing Trading

Swing trading is a speculative strategy in the forex market where traders hold positions for durations ranging from two days to several weeks. Unlike day traders who close all positions before the market shuts, swing traders aim to profit from an anticipated price move or 'swing'.


According to the 2022 Triennial Central Bank Survey by the Bank for International Settlements (BIS), the forex market sees a daily turnover of approximately $7.5 trillion. This immense liquidity ensures that technical patterns used in swing trading—such as trends, reversals, and breakouts—remain highly reliable compared to lower-volume markets. For beginners, learning how to swing trade forex provides a less stressful environment than scalping, as it requires less time glued to screens while offering significant profit potential.

II. The Mechanics of a Swing Trade

Swing Highs and Swing Lows

The foundation of swing trading lies in identifying price 'extremes'. A Swing High is a peak reached by price before it retracts, while a Swing Low is a trough reached before price bounces back. Successfully mapping these points allows traders to identify the current market structure (Bullish, Bearish, or Ranging).

Timeframes for Analysis

Professional swing traders typically employ a 'Top-Down' analysis approach:

  • Weekly (W1): Used to define the primary long-term trend.
  • Daily (D1): The main chart for identifying key support and resistance levels.
  • 4-Hour (H4): Often used to refine entry and exit points to maximize the Risk-to-Reward ratio.

Holding Periods and Psychology

The psychological advantage of swing trading is the reduction of 'market noise'. By focusing on larger timeframes, traders avoid the erratic price spikes caused by minor news events, focusing instead on broader macroeconomic shifts and sustained momentum.

III. Essential Swing Trading Strategies

Trend Following (Pullback Trading)

This is the most common method when learning how to swing trade forex. Traders wait for a clear trend to establish itself and then enter a position during a temporary retracement (pullback). For instance, in an uptrend, a trader looks for a swing low that aligns with a historical support level or a moving average.

Breakout and Retest

Breakout trading involves entering a trade when the price moves above a known resistance level or below a support level. To increase the probability of success, many swing traders wait for a 'retest'—where the price returns to the broken level to confirm it has flipped from resistance to support (or vice versa).

Reversal Trading

Reversal strategies focus on identifying when a trend has exhausted itself. Using momentum oscillators like the Relative Strength Index (RSI), traders look for 'overbought' or 'oversold' conditions combined with candlestick patterns like the 'Engulfing' or 'Pin Bar' to signal a change in direction.

IV. Technical Indicators and Tools

Reliable swing trading requires a blend of trend and volatility indicators. Below is a comparison of tools commonly used by professional traders on Bitget:

Indicator Category Tool Name Primary Function in Swing Trading
Trend 50/200-day EMA Determines the long-term market bias and dynamic support levels.
Momentum MACD Identifies changes in the strength and direction of a trend.
Volatility Bollinger Bands Helps set realistic targets by identifying price 'extremes'.
Risk Management ATR (Average True Range) Calculates market volatility to determine stop-loss distance.

The table above highlights that no single indicator is a 'holy grail'. Instead, a combination—such as using the 200-day EMA for trend direction and the ATR for stop-loss placement—creates a robust framework for managing trades across various market conditions.

V. Risk Management and Cost Analysis

Stop-Loss Placement

Because swing trades are held for days, stop-losses must be wide enough to withstand daily fluctuations. A common rule is to place the stop-loss just beyond the previous swing high or low. Aiming for a Risk-to-Reward ratio of at least 1:2 is standard for maintaining long-term profitability.

Swap Fees and Rollovers

In the forex market, holding a position overnight incurs a 'swap' fee based on the interest rate differential between the two currencies.
